Buy to let lending in the UK has fallen in the first quarter according to new data from the Council of Mortgage Lenders. According to the report buy to let investors borrowed £3.7 billion in Q1, representing a fall of 5% over Q4 2011...

According to the latest survey of the US commercial real estate market by the National Association of Realtors, while the commercial investment market showed signs of recovery in 2011 it was hampered by tight lending in the lower end of the market...
